Why Choose a 350Z Carbon Fiber Hood

A 350Z carbon fiber hood offers several benefits. The lightweight nature of carbon fiber significantly reduces the front-end weight, which directly improves handling and acceleration. The sleek carbon fiber weave provides a unique visual appeal, making the car stand out without excessive aftermarket styling. Additionally, a well-manufactured hood ensures heat resistance, durability, and proper fitment. Choosing a customized hood allows customers to balance style and performance according to their needs.

Carbon Fiber Production Lines for 350Z Carbon Fiber Hood

Different production methods are suitable for different types of carbon fiber parts. For a 350Z carbon fiber hood, the following production lines are most relevant:

  • Vacuum Infusion Process – Ensures a smooth surface, consistent resin distribution, and reliable structural strength. This method is ideal for hoods requiring a balance between weight and durability.
  • Prepreg Autoclave Molding – Offers the highest strength-to-weight ratio, widely used in motorsport-grade hoods. This process is suitable for customers who prioritize performance and premium quality.
  • Wet Lay-Up Process – A more cost-effective option, often chosen for customers focusing on appearance rather than maximum strength. It can still achieve a stylish look but is heavier compared to prepreg methods.

Not every production line is necessary for every customer. For example, racing enthusiasts may choose prepreg autoclave production, while casual owners may prefer vacuum infusion to balance cost and performance. The difference in production methods is also the main reason why the price of 350Z carbon fiber hood varies in the market.

Customization Options for 350Z Carbon Fiber Hood

The customization of a 350Z carbon fiber hood is highly flexible. Customers can select design variations, weave styles, finishing options, and functional features. Following the standard customization process does not incur additional costs. However, when customers request forged carbon fiber, extra thickness in layering, or multiple additional air vents and outlets, the hood needs to be redesigned with new stress calculations and modified lay-up methods, which leads to an increase in overall cost. Below is a breakdown of the most common customization categories:

1. Carbon Fiber Weave Patterns

The weave pattern is one of the most visible aspects of a carbon fiber hood. Choices include plain weave, twill weave, and forged carbon. Twill weave is most popular for 350Z hoods due to its stylish diagonal pattern, while forged carbon gives a more exotic and modern appearance.

2. Finishing Options

Surface finish influences both aesthetics and durability. The two main finishes are gloss and matte. Gloss enhances the reflective effect of the weave, while matte creates a subtle, understated style. Both finishes provide UV protection and resistance against environmental damage when properly coated.

3. Structural Reinforcements

Depending on the intended use, customers may choose additional reinforcements for extra strength. Reinforced layers around hinge mounting points and latch areas ensure long-term durability without compromising weight savings.

4. Ventilation and Functional Design

Some 350Z carbon fiber hoods include functional vents to improve engine cooling. This is especially useful for track drivers or turbocharged builds. Vent placement and size can be customized depending on the customer’s requirements.

5. Paint and Coating Options

While many owners prefer the raw carbon fiber look, painting the hood in body color or adding clear coat layers is another customization path. This allows blending with the car’s original paint while still benefiting from reduced weight.

Factors Influencing 350Z Carbon Fiber Hood Customization Cost

Several factors determine the cost of customizing a 350Z carbon fiber hood. These include the chosen production method, material quality, customization complexity, and finishing requirements. Unlike simple cosmetic modifications, a hood is a structural component, meaning material integrity and production precision play a direct role in pricing.

1. Production Line Selection

As mentioned earlier, prepreg autoclave is more expensive due to high material and equipment costs, but it offers unmatched strength. Vacuum infusion balances performance and affordability, while wet lay-up is the most economical choice. Customers should select a production line based on intended use.

2. Material Quality

The grade of carbon fiber and type of resin also affect the cost. Higher-grade aerospace-level fibers and epoxy resins enhance performance but increase overall expenses. Standard automotive-grade materials are sufficient for most street-driven 350Z hoods.

3. Custom Design Complexity

Adding custom vents, unique contours, or reinforced sections requires additional molds and labor. The more complex the design, the higher the production cost.

4. Surface Treatment

Gloss or matte UV-resistant clear coating requires careful application to ensure long-term durability. Additional painting or customized finishes also add to the expense.

5. Order Quantity

Single-piece customization generally costs more than bulk production. For individual 350Z owners, the focus is on achieving the desired quality in a one-off piece rather than volume savings.

Performance vs Aesthetics: Making the Right Choice

When customizing a 350Z carbon fiber hood, customers often ask whether they should prioritize performance or appearance. The answer depends on usage. For daily driving, vacuum infusion production with a twill weave and gloss finish provides a stylish and practical choice. For racing applications, prepreg autoclave with structural reinforcements and functional vents is recommended. For those mainly concerned with styling at an affordable cost, wet lay-up with a matte finish can be suitable.
